Darolutamide with or without standard therapy for Stage II-IIIA, AR+, TNBC

This study is looking at how a drug called darolutamide, given alone or with standard chemotherapy, affects patients with stage II-IIIA androgen receptor positive (AR+) triple-negative breast cancer (TNBC) before surgery. Standard chemotherapy often includes drugs like carboplatin and cyclophosphamide. Researchers want to see if adding darolutamide helps reduce the growth of cancer cells. You might be able to join if you are 18 or older, have newly diagnosed AR+ TNBC, and meet other health requirements. The main goal is to compare changes in a marker called Ki-67, which shows how fast cancer cells are growing. The study plans to enroll 51 participants, but its current status is unclear.

Eligibility criteria

Inclusion

Signed and dated written informed consent as well as the ability to understand and the willingness to sign written consent prior to study registration
Male or female ≥ 18 years of age on the day of signing informed consent
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1
Histologically confirmed newly diagnosed breast cancer with the following requirements:
\<10% staining for estrogen receptor (ER) and progesterone receptor (PR) by immunohistochemistry (IHC)
HER2 negative by fluorescence in situ hybridization (FISH)
AR positive: defined as ≥ 80% staining for AR by IHC
Primary tumor clinically or radiographically ≥ 1cm in size or stage II-IIIA and eligible for neoadjuvant treatment
Absolute neutrophil count (ANC) ≥ 1500/µL (≤ 28 days prior to first dose of protocol-indicated treatment)
Platelets ≥ 100,000/µL (≤ 28 days prior to first dose of protocol-indicated treatment)
Hemoglobin ≥ 9.0 g/dL or ≥ 5.6 mmol/L (≤ 28 days prior to first dose of protocol-indicated treatment)
Estimated glomerular filtration rate (eGFR) ≥ 60 mL/min (as calculated by the Cockcroft-Gault Formula or calculated/measured by an alternative established institutional standard consistently applied across participants at the site) (≤ 28 days prior to first dose of protocol-indicated treatment)
Total bilirubin ≤ 1.5 times institutional upper limit of normal (ULN), or direct bilirubin ≤ ULN for participants with total bilirubin \> 1.5 x ULN (≤ 28 days prior to first dose of protocol-indicated treatment)
Aspartate aminotransferase (AST) (serum glutamic oxaloacetic transaminase \[SGOT\]) and alanine aminotransferase (ALT) (serum glutamic pyruvic transaminase \[SGPT\]) ≤ 2.5 times institutional upper limit of normal (ULN) (≤ 28 days prior to first dose of protocol-indicated treatment)
Calcium ≤ 11.5 mg/dL or ≤ 2.9 mmol/L; in patients with albumin outside the normal range, calcium (corrected for albumin) must be ≤ 11.5 mg/dL or ≤ 2.9 mmol/L (≤ 28 days prior to first dose of protocol-indicated treatment)
Women must not be breastfeeding and further agree to not breastfeed during study treatment and for at least 120 days after completion of treatment
A woman of childbearing potential (WOCBP) must have a negative serum or urine pregnancy test during screening within 21 days prior to receiving first dose of protocol-indicated treatment, and must agree to follow instructions for using acceptable contraception from the time of signing consent, and until at least 120 days after completion of treatment
Men must refrain from donating sperm for at least 120 days after completion of treatment
A man able to father children who is sexually active with a WOCBP must agree to follow instructions for using acceptable contraception, from the time of signing consent, and until at least 120 days after completion of treatment

Exclusion

Non-resectable breast cancer as assessed by the primary treating surgeon or evidence of metastatic disease
Malignancies other than TNBC within 5 years prior to randomization, with the exception of those with a negligible risk of metastases or death and treated with expected curative outcome (such as adequately treated carcinoma in situ of the cervix or basal or squamous cell skin cancer)
Patient is pregnant or breastfeeding
Patients with moderate hepatic impairment (Child-Pugh Class B cirrhosis or higher)
Is currently participating in or within four weeks prior to receiving first dose of study treatment in a study of an investigational agent or investigational device
Participants who have entered the follow-up phase of an investigational study may participate as long as it has been four weeks after the last dose or last exposure to the previous investigational agent or investigational device
Recipient of previous allogeneic tissue/solid organ transplant
Known severe hypersensitivity (≥ Grade 3) to study drug, pembrolizumab, carboplatin, doxorubicin/epirubicin, paclitaxel, or cyclophosphamide and/or any of the excipients of these drugs
History of myocarditis or pericarditis or other known underlying heart disease that is clinically significant by investigator judgment (for example, cardiomyopathy, congestive heart failure with New York Heart Association \[NYHA\] functional classification III or IV, symptomatic arrhythmia not controlled by medication, unstable angina, history of acute myocardial infarction). History of cerebrovascular accident (including transient ischemic attack \[TIA\]) within the past six months (24 weeks) prior to starting study treatment
Uncontrolled intercurrent illness including, but not limited to, ongoing or active infection/sepsis, or psychiatric illness/social situations that would limit compliance with study requirements
Known conditions that would preclude the use of checkpoint inhibitors
  • Mean ΔKi-67 levelBaseline up to 5 years

    The two-sample t-test as well as the Wilcoxon Rank-Sum test will be applied to examine the magnitude of ΔKi-67 between the two study arms. The 95% confidence interval (CI) of the mean difference of ΔKi-67 level between two treatment arms will be reported.
